I work for start-up Tech company and we use Jira-On- demand for bug tracking and I'm currently in the process of researching for test case management software for their our needs. Just wanted to get your opinions/thoughts on which software you think one is best and why?
Our needs
- Easy to use and learn (access to tutorials) because its not just QA that will use it
- Quick to move testcases to another module to another
- Record what testcases/modules per test and statuses (how many passes and fails)
- Ideally link to Jira on demand so if a testcase fails, you can create/link a bug in Jira
Software I've looked at so far
1.) Zephyr - Can only use Enterprise Edition with Jira On Demand it seems, Zephyr for Jira seems to have more functionality/features?
2.) TestRail - Doesn't seem that much support/tutorials to learn it
3.) Test Center - Seems require alot of process and adminstration to setup/use successful.

Zephyr JIRA plugin is what you need. Not sure if it works for On-Demand. But if it does, it meets the requirements you listed above. We have it and use it the same way. You can install JIRA locally and Zephyr trial to test.
